Turning the Dream into Reality
Take the first concrete step: treat each session as a project. Log every spin, every free entry, every win. Use a spreadsheet or a simple note‑app. Identify your win‑rate, your variance, and your break‑even point. Next, set a “professional budget” that you never exceed, no matter how tempting the next giveaway looks.
